Gardaí investigate drive-by shooting in Limerick

Shot fired at parked car in Ballinacurra Weston area of city

GARDAÍ are appealing for witnesses following a shooting incident at Hyde Avenue, Ballinacurra Weston, Limerick on July 21.
 
The incident occurred at approximately 7:45pm when a firearm was discharged in the direction of a parked car on Hyde Avenue.
 
No injuries have been reported. The suspected offender fled the scene in a silver Nissan Maxima.
 
No arrests have been made. Investigations are ongoing.
 
Gardaí are appealing to anyone with any information on this incident to contact them. In particular, anyone who was in the Hyde Avenue or Ballinacurra Weston area between 7.30pm – 8pm. 
Any road who may have camera footage (including dash-cam) are asked to make this available.
 
The investigation team can be contacted at Roxboro Road Garda Station on 061 214340, the Garda Confidential Line 1800 666 111 or any Garda Station.
